Understanding the Core Mechanics of Aviator
At its heart, Aviator is a provably fair game, meaning the outcome of each round is determined by a cryptographic hash that is made available for public verification. This transparency safeguards against manipulation and ensures a level playing field for all participants. The random number generator (RNG) within the game dictates when the plane will “crash,” and this crash point is determined before the round begins. This makes the game feel genuinely unpredictable, despite the underlying mathematical probabilities at play. Players can observe the history of previous rounds, noting multiplier trends, though it’s crucial to understand that past results don’t guarantee future outcomes.

The Role of Randomness and Volatility
The inherent randomness in Aviator is what makes it thrilling, but it also introduces the element of volatility. Volatility refers to the degree of fluctuation in payouts. A highly volatile game can have periods of relatively low payouts interspersed with occasional large wins. Understanding this volatility is crucial for sound bankroll management. Players need to be prepared for losing streaks and avoid chasing losses. Smart betting strategies often involve starting with small bets and gradually increasing them as confidence grows, rather than betting large sums from the beginning. Recognizing that each round is independent and avoiding the gambler’s fallacy—believing that a crash is “due” after a long series of increasing multipliers—is paramount.
Bankroll Management & Responsible Gambling
Effective bankroll management is the cornerstone of any successful Aviator strategy. Before you begin, establish a budget and stick to it. Never bet more than you can afford to lose. A common rule of thumb is to risk only 1-5% of your bankroll on any single bet. Implement a stop-loss limit, which is a predetermined amount of money you’re willing to lose before stopping play. Conversely, set a profit target – once you’ve reached that target, cash out and enjoy your winnings. Responsible gambling also includes taking frequent breaks, avoiding playing under the influence of alcohol or drugs, and recognizing the signs of problem gambling. If you feel you may have a gambling problem, seek help from a reputable organization.

The Double Bet Approach: A Hedge Against Losses
The double bet approach, as mentioned earlier, involves placing two simultaneous bets. The first bet is intended as a safety net, with a quick cash out at a low multiplier (around 1.1x to 1.3x). This secures a small profit or at least recovers your initial investment. The second bet is the ‘riskier’ bet, allowing it to run for a much higher multiplier. This dual approach offers a degree of protection, as the gains from the second bet can offset potential losses from the first, and vice versa. It’s important to note that this strategy requires a larger bankroll to accommodate the two simultaneous bets and needs careful monitoring to ensure that payouts are still meaningful.

Advanced Techniques and Considerations
Beyond the basic strategies, there are more advanced techniques that experienced Aviator players employ. These often involve analyzing historical multiplier data, identifying trends, and adjusting bet sizes accordingly. Martingale style betting involves doubling your stake each time you lose, hoping to recover your losses with a single win. This can be extremely risky, as a long losing streak can quickly deplete your bankroll, since it requires significant capital. Another technique is using ‘auto cash-out’ features, which are available on many Aviator platforms. This feature allows you to pre-set a target multiplier, and the game will automatically cash out your bet when that multiplier is reached. Employing these automated features can help mitigate emotional decision-making.

The Psychological Aspect of Playing Aviator
Playing Aviator isn’t solely about mathematical calculations; the psychological aspect also plays a substantial role. The excitement of watching the multiplier rise can lead to emotional decision-making, such as letting a bet ride for too long in pursuit of a larger payout, only to see it crash before you can cash out. Fear of missing out (FOMO) is a common pitfall, where players continue playing after a series of wins, hoping to extend their winning streak, only to eventually lose their profits. Discipline and emotional control are vital for consistent success. Stick to your predetermined strategy, avoid chasing losses, and take breaks when you’re feeling overwhelmed.
